A ballet teacher and a hockey player are brought together by fate in this big-hearted second chance romance by the USA Today bestselling author of Earls Trip.

"A heartwarming, healing romcom worth staying up late to finish." —Abby Jimenez, New York Times bestselling author of Say You'll Remember Me

Once upon a time teenage Aurora Evans met a hockey player at the Mall of America. He was from Canada. And soon, he was the perfect fake boyfriend, a get-out-of-jail-free card for all kinds of sticky situations. I can't go to prom. I'm going to be visiting my boyfriend in Canada. He was just what she needed to cover her social awkwardness. He never had to know. It wasn't like she was ever going to see him again ...

Years later, Aurora is teaching kids’ dance classes and battling panic and eating disorders—souvenirs from her failed ballet career—when pro hockey player Mike Martin walks in with his daughter. Mike’s honesty about his struggles with widowhood helps Aurora confront some of her own demons, and the two forge an unlikely friendship.

There’s just one problem: Mike is the boy she spent years pretending was her “Canadian boyfriend.” The longer she keeps her secret, the more she knows it will shatter the trust between them. But to have the life she wants, she needs to tackle the most important thing of all—believing in herself.

The narration was great. I was pretty annoyed with some of the writing. Especially the FMC constantly calling the MMC by his full name, Mike Martin. I think it discussed grief and eating disorders in a realistic way which was nice to see. I thought the final conflict was kinda dumb. Her moving in with him was also not my favorite but I get why it went that way. Overall just meh. I didn’t hate it, but I feel like if I was reading it I might not have finished it.

This book was an absolute delight. Don't let the cartoon cover fool you it deals with some heavy topics including overcoming grief of a spouse, but Aurora and Mike were such a lovely couple and had great chemistry. Plus I loved all of the Canadian elements in it, including butter tarts and nanimo bars.

I listened to the audiobook and both narrators Joshua Jackson and Emily Ellet were wonderful narrators. I highly recommend this book.
